I'm the "cool guy" who saunters in while several people are in line in front of him, but who never actually commits to the queue. I then walk over to the bar area to look at today's coffee blend selections, and after a few minutes of indecisively shifting my weight from one leg to the other, I catch one of the baristas in the spare second when he or she is not actively making a drink or fixing a pastry and try to place an order. It's usually something overly specific and confusing, such as "I need one of those Snickers Bars, but with decaf espresso and ice." I don't seem to notice that five people are in the line a mere four feet to my right, or that another three or four people are patiently waiting for their orders. I get miffed when the barista tells me to go get in line to place my order, and when I finally get to the front and they ask me what I'd like, I get angry because I already placed my order five minutes ago while they were busy making drinks for other customers.
